What are gas fees?
Before we dive into the impact of Eth 2.0 on gas fees, let's first understand what gas fees are. In simple terms, gas fees are the fees that users pay to execute transactions on the Ethereum network. These fees are paid in Ether, the native cryptocurrency of the Ethereum network. Gas fees are typically measured in Gwei, which is a unit of Ether.
The amount of gas fees that users need to pay depends on the complexity of the transaction and the current demand for network resources. When the demand for network resources is high, gas fees tend to be higher as well. This is because users are competing for limited resources, and the network prioritizes transactions with higher gas fees.
